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: There is no other illness other than seizure associated with fever. The mother is not a hospital staff. The mother is fluent in Persian. The mother will have read and write literacy. Samples will reside in Zahedan. Have a child admitted at the age of 6 months to 6 years old with seizure. There is no history of epilepsy in the child and the family. The mother has no history of anxiety and depression disorders or the mother is not being treated with psychiatric drugs. The first childhood admission.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Did not attend more than one session
